NTP网络时间同步服务器配置指南

2024-11-24 1 0

在当前数字化、网络化的信息时代,时间的准确性对于企业运营、数据处理、日常通讯等方面至关重要。这就涉及到了一个经典的问题:如何确保计算机网络中各个节点的时间统一而准确?答案是利用NTP(Network Time Protocol)服务器实现网络时间同步。下面就来细说如何配置NTP网络时间同步服务器,帮助你在确保系统时间准确性方面迈出坚实的一步。

理解NTP

首先,NTP是一种网络协议,旨在通过网络将时间信息传播到各个计算机系统中,确保它们的系统时间与世界标准时间(UTC)保持一致。NTP能够提供高精度的时间同步,误差通常在毫秒级别。

选择NTP服务器

在配置之前,你需要选择一个或多个NTP服务器。理想情况下,这些服务器应该是靠近你的网络、可靠并且稳定的。许多组织选择使用公共NTP服务器,如time.windows.compool.ntp.org

NTP服务器配置步骤

1. 安装NTP软件

大多数现代操作系统(包括Windows、Linux和macOS)都内置了NTP功能,或者你可以轻松地从官方源安装NTP包。例如,在Linux上,你可以使用sudo apt-get install ntp(对于Debian系列)或sudo yum install ntp(对于RedHat系列)来安装。

2. 配置NTP服务

安装完NTP软件后,你需要编辑其配置文件。对于Linux系统,这通常位于/etc/ntp.conf

在配置文件中,你需要指定你想要同步时间的NTP服务器。例如:

server 0.pool.ntp.org
server 1.pool.ntp.org
server 2.pool.ntp.org
server 3.pool.ntp.org

此外,你还可以设置一些高级选项来优化同步过程,但对于大多数用户来说,默认设置就足够了。

配置文件示例

3. 启动NTP服务

配置好NTP服务器后,下一步就是启动NTP服务。在Linux上,这通常涉及到执行如下命令:

sudo systemctl start ntp

确保NTP服务设置为开机启动:

sudo systemctl enable ntp

4. 验证配置

最后,你需要验证NTP服务是否正常工作。你可以使用以下命令检查服务状态:

ntpq -p

这将显示当前同步的NTP服务器以及一些同步详情。

NTP同步详情

结语

确保系统时间的准确性是维护网络健康的重要一环,而配置NTP服务器是实现这一目标的有效手段。虽然过程可能会涉及到一些技术细节,但按照上述步骤操作,大多数用户应该都能够顺利完成配置。随着时间的推移,维护准确的系统时间将为你的网络安全、日常运营和数据处理带来长远的好处。

相关文章

基于Nginx的反向代理与负载均衡配置

发布评论